How Management Qualities Drive Organisational Development

The success of any organization is deeply linked with the quality of its leadership. Strong management qualities are the structure upon which organisations are developed, and they play a critical role in assisting the company through both difficulties and chances. From driving innovation to handling groups, leadership qualities effect every element of company operations.

Among the most substantial reasons leadership qualities are so crucial is their ability to influence and influence others. Leaders who have qualities such as integrity, vision, and empathy have the ability to get the trust and regard of their employees. This trust results in greater levels of inspiration and engagement, as employees feel valued and confident in their leaders' capabilities. Leaders who can successfully motivate their teams create a positive workplace where people are motivated to contribute their best efforts. This leads to increased efficiency, creativity, and general task satisfaction, which ultimately benefits the company's bottom line.

Leadership qualities are also essential when it concerns decision-making. Leaders are continuously confronted with choices that impact the organisation's instructions, and the capability to make sound, notified options is necessary. Qualities such as analytical thinking, decisiveness, and flexibility enable leaders to assess situations quickly and choose the best strategy. Effective decision-making assists the organisation stay nimble and responsive to modifications in the market, making sure long-lasting success. Leaders with strong decision-making abilities are also able to guide their teams through uncertain times, maintaining focus and clearness when others might feel overloaded.

Another factor leadership qualities are so important is their role in cultivating development. Leaders who have qualities like creativity and a determination to take risks create an environment where originalities can grow. Development is important for staying competitive in today's fast-paced organization world, and leaders who motivate creative thinking are more likely to discover options that provide their company a competitive edge. By cultivating a culture of development, leaders not only drive business forward however also bring in leading talent, as staff members are drawn to organisations that worth creativity and forward-thinking.

Lastly, management qualities are key to handling change within an organisation. Change is inescapable in any service, whether due to internal factors or external market shifts. Leaders who have qualities such as durability, communication, and flexibility are better geared up to manage change efficiently. They can help their groups navigate shifts smoothly, making sure that workers stay focused and encouraged during durations of uncertainty. Leaders who can handle change with self-confidence and clarity construct trust within the organisation, allowing business to remain steady and resilient in the face of difficulties.
